When picking power tools, professionals and diy lovers should choose in between corded or cordless power tools. Depending on the kind of jobs and workplace environment, one may be more ideal than the other. Corded power tools supply a continuous flow of electricity, making them perfect for durable tasks and long-lasting projects. They also usually use a longer run time than cordless power tools, though this will vary depending upon the brand name and battery used. The disadvantage to utilizing corded power tools is that they depend on an electric outlet for power, restricting movement. This can be a substantial problem when working on ladders or in tight areas that don't have access to power outlets. Additionally, the length of power cords can create a tripping risk or be mistakenly cut, leaving employees without access to the tool they need. With the increase of cordless technology, a growing number of individuals are selecting to go cordless when purchasing new power tools. Battery-powered tools are lighter and more compact than their corded counterparts, using higher movement and ease of use. Additionally, lots of battery-powered power tools can be found in sets that can share the same battery or charger, making it easier to maintain consistency across numerous tools. Combo kits consisting of cordless power tools range from two-tool sets to collections that include approximately eight or more tools. The majority of frequently, these combinations consist of a drill/driver for drilling and standard fastener driving, in addition to an effect driver for tasks that need increased driving power.
